Summary

Modern C focuses on the new and unique features of modern C programming. The book is based on the latest C standards and offers an up-to-date perspective on this tried-and-true language.

Purchase of the print book includes a free eBook in PDF, Kindle, and ePub formats from Manning Publications.

About the Technology

C is extraordinarily modern for a 50-year-old programming language. Whether youre writing embedded code, low-level system routines, or high-performance applications, C is up to the challenge. This unique book, based on the latest C standards, exposes a modern perspective of this tried-and-true language.

About the Book

Modern C introduces you to modern day C programming, emphasizing the unique and new features of this powerful language. For new C coders, it starts with fundamentals like structure, grammar, compilation, and execution. From there, youll advance to control structures, data types, operators, and functions, as you gain a deeper understanding of whats happening under the hood. In the final chapters, youll explore performance considerations, reentrancy, atomicity, threads, and type-generic programming. Youll code as you go with concept-reinforcing exercises and skill-honing challenges along the way.

Whats inside

  • Operators and functions
  • Pointers, threading, and atomicity
  • Cs memory model
  • Hands-on exercises

About the Reader

For programmers comfortable writing simple programs in a language like Java, Python, Ruby, C#, C++, or C.

About the Author

Jens Gustedt is a senior scientist at the French National Institute for Computer Science and Control (INRIA) and co-editor of the ISO C standard.
